7 nabbed, P1.4-M shabu seized in Zambo Peninsula

Zamboanga Peninsula map ZAMBOANGA CITY - Units under the Police Regional Office-9 (PRO-9) have arrested seven drug suspects and seized some PHP1.4 million worth of illegal drugs in separate operations over the past week here in the Zamboanga Peninsula. The latest drug haul happened Friday in Sitio Aticlan, Barangay Arena Blanco, here. Col. Richard Verseles, operations chief of the Area Police Command-Western Mindanao (APC-WM), said suspect Nasser Alih was arrested in possession of some 100 grams of suspected shabu worth PHP680,000 around 1:50 p.m. Friday by the Special Operations Unit-9 in Sitio Aticlan. Also seized from Alih were a cellular phone and PHP500 bill placed on top of a bundle of boodle money. Another suspect, Almudzrin Atalad, 40, was arrested by the Regional Drug Enforcement Unit-9 (RDEU-9) in a buy-bust operation around 11:04 a.m. Thursday in Barangay Baliwasan, also in this city. The RDEU-9 reported that Atalad yielded some 50 grams of suspected shabu worth PHP340,000, a sling bag, and PHP1,000 marked money. Maj. Shellamie Chang, PRO-9 information officer, said that Helen Atang, 34, and Abdul Aziz Kudarat, 25, were caught in possession of some PHP40,800 worth of suspected shabu in a buy-bust operation around 6:06 p.m. Thursday in Barangay La Piedad, Isabela City, Basilan. Chang said the arresting team also seized PHP500 marked money from the two suspects. Col. Alexander Lorenzo, Zamboanga City Police Office director, reported that two drug suspects, Erwin Manuel, 44, and Juli Harris Camlian, 29, were arrested in an anti-drug operation around 2 a.m. Wednesday in Mango Drive, Barangay Tumaga, here. Lorenzo said the duo yielded some 50 grams of suspected shabu worth PHP340,000, boodle money consisting of 100 pieces of PHP1,000 bills topped with a PHP500 marked money. Col. Albert Larubis, Zamboanga Sibugay police director, said suspect Muin Dunggan, 43, was arrested in a buy-bust operation around 7 p.m. Tuesday in Purok Sweet Rose, Barangay Kitabog, Titay town. Larubis said recovered from Dunggan's possession were some 10 grams of suspected shabu worth PHP68,000, a smartphone, 54 pieces of PHP1,000 bills as boodle money topped with a genuine PHP1,000 bill as marked money. Zambo City adds checkpoints to contain ASF spread

Zamboanga City checkpoint versus African swine fever (Photo courtesy of City Hall-PIO) ZAMBOANGA CITY - Additional checkpoints have been established here to prohibit the entry of live hogs, pork products, and by-products, allowing only those with veterinary health certificates. The Office of the City Veterinarian (OCVet) on Saturday was still waiting for the result of the confirmatory tests of three blood samples that tested positive for African swine fever (ASF) at the Regional Animal Disease Diagnostic Laboratory (RADDL) of the Department of Agriculture in Ipil, Zamboanga Sibugay. The confirmatory tests were done at RADDL General Santos City as the Ipil laboratory has no equipment to determine if the viral infection is due to ASF, hog cholera, and porcine reproductive respiratory syndrome, which all have similar signs and symptoms. Dr. Arnedo Agbayani, assistant OCVet chief, does not foresee a shortage of meat products since a local shopping mall, which has its own ASF-free farm in Koronadal City, can supply up to 60 percent of the local market demand. Checkpoints were established in Barangay Tagasilay to monitor entry from Vitali District. Vitali District is one of the seven veterinary districts in the city and is composed of Barangays Tigbalabag, Taguiti, Tumitus, Vitali, Tagasilay, Mangusu, Tictapul, Limaong, Licomo, and Sibulao. A checkpoint was also placed in Barangay Licomo, the city's boundary on the east coast. Agbayani said one of the three blood samples came from Barangay Mangusu. Zamboanga Sibugay had earlier reported ASF cases in R.T. Lim, Titay, Buug, Alicia and Ipil towns. "In the meantime, we are taking proactive measures pending the result of the confirmatory examination," Agbayani said in an interview. The confirmation and declaration of ASF will be done only by the Bureau of Animal Industry. (PNA) }

Mindanao coops get P160-M farm machinery from RCEF

BETTER FARMING.The Department of Agriculture has turned over another batch of farm machinery to cooperatives and associations in Mindanao. These equipment were procured under the Rice Competitiveness Enhancement Fund (RCEF) Mechanization Program.(DA PhilMech photo) MANILA-Farmers and stakeholders have been slowly reaping the benefits under the Rice Competitiveness Enhancement Fund (RCEF). Recently, the Department of Agriculture- Philippine Center for Postharvest Development and Mechanization (DA-PhilMech) turned over some PHP159.5 million worth of farm machinery to members of farmers' cooperatives and associations (FCAs) in Agusan del Norte and Zamboanga Sibugay. On Tuesday, a total of PHP81.4 million worth of machinery grants were distributed to 25 qualified FCAs in the province of Agusan Del Norte during the machinery turnover held in Butuan City. The DA said some 2,750 farmer-members will benefit from the distributed machines which were procured under this year's RCEF. Around 5,460 farmer members who belong to 35 qualified FCAs in the province of Zamboanga Sibugay also received PHP78.1 worth of machinery grants under the RCEF Mechanization Program in early November. A total of 50 units of agri-machinery were distributed including Four-Wheel Tractor, Hand Tractor, Floating Tiller, PTO-Driven Disc Plow/Harrow, Walk-behind Rice Transplanter, Riding Type Rice Transplanter, Rice Combine Harvester, Rice Threshers, Recirculating Dryer, Single Pass Rice Mill, Multi-Stage Rice Mill, and Impeller Rice Mill. The distribution covers the 12 rice-producing municipalities of the province which includes Diplahan, Buug, Ipil, Siay, Roseller T. Lim, Tungawan, Alicia, Payao, Imelda, Malangas,Kabasalan, and Titay. According to DA-PhilMech, around 1,200 to 1,600 farm machinery will be distributed to FCAs every year. The FCAs with good performance can be selected again for the distribution of their lacking farm machinery. The allocation of machinery is based on the urgency and needs of the FCAs. The DA also prioritizes provinces and municipalities that are considered rice-producing based on the Philippine Rice Industry Road Map. They are also considering FCAs that are lacking with farm machinery. The goal of the RCEF Mechanization Program is to reduce the cost of rice production from PHP2 - PHP3 per kilogram through the use of accurate, effective, and complete set of machinery to reduce postharvest losses by 3-5 percent through the use of appropriate and efficient postharvest machinery. The program is part of the annual PHP10-billion RCEF created under the Rice Tariffication Law to enhance the competitiveness of Filipino rice farmers in a liberalized rice industry. The other three RCEF components, with their corresponding budget for six years that started in 2019, include seeds distribution (PHP3 billion), credit (PHP1 billion), and extension and training (PHP1 billion).
